Computing server industry has been rising rapidly and technology is regenerating more and more often. Customer application market becomes bigger and bigger especially in recent years traditional industries started developing their information system; internet, information security and aeronautic industries are growing faster and faster which defines higher requirement for computing server products. These requirements are higher performance, better security, more reliable and more stable. RAID (Redundant Array of Inexpensive/Independent Disks) adapter is one of the key parts in computing server to support the above requirements. SAS (Serial Attached SCSI (Small Computer System Interface)) is the major next generation storage interface. Therefore designing SAS RAID adapter is vital to master the core technology of server storage sub-system, improve product uniqueness and make it more competitive also drive down the cost.Background of this thesis is the project "Inspur High Performance Server" - One of the national 863 program projects done in Inspur Group High Performance Server & Storage Technology Laboratory. This project is to resolve technology obstacles such as expanding on demand, high speed communication, central management and control, remote monitoring etc. Meanwhile it setup firm foundation for China own intelligence property high performance server, improved product uniqueness and competitiveness also drove down the cost. Goal of this project is to design a RAID adapter base on ROC architecture, meet high speed communication requirement in high performance server products as well as improve system security and reliability.Design guide of this project is splitting into modules. System hardware was divided into four modules as Memory, PCI Express, SAS and Power, they are "Bones" of the system. Schematic design, PCB design, debugging and test of each module are "Soul" of the system. The most optimized design solution of SAS RAID adapter was achieved. Also have done in-depth analysis and study of DDR2 memory, PCI Express and SAS protocol, core chips, learned excellent experience on high speed signal PCB design, signal integrity test and created an efficient total test solution for SAS RAID adapter.This paper starts from RAID technology and evolution, and then base on the developing trend expatiates the design of ROC architecture SAS RAID adapter. The hardware design includes schematic of memory, PCI-Express, SAS interface and power supply sub-system.Next part of the thesis is SAS RAID adapter PCB design. In this part there are detail depictions of component layout and high speed signal tracing which considers memory PCB design the most important part. Thereafter is a summary of issues found in debug stage and solutions for each of them.Last part is the test of SAS RAID mechanical, signal integrity, function, compatibility, reliability and performance. Design target was met. Conclusion of this thesis summarized contents of the whole project, also proposed next topic of the study according to technology developing trend.
